Output 66dfd1457d5c2033b908014b55bfc652abe415db16b75264d080479873786a02:1

value
33512
script pubkey
OP_0 OP_PUSHBYTES_20 c586ff89b6147685d16f7bc0d8a99ba2705b3f2d
address
bc1qckr0lzdkz3mgt5t000qd32vm5fc9k0edazgw95
transaction
66dfd1457d5c2033b908014b55bfc652abe415db16b75264d080479873786a02
confirmations
213635
spent
true